About This Book

The soft rustle of paper fills the air as Rose unfolds a map unlike any other — vibrant with colors and secrets only she can see. Every line and swirl leads her to a new, magical world waiting to be explored. With her heart as her compass, Rose discovers that the greatest adventures come from inside.

Quick Assessment

This beautifully illustrated early reader encourages creativity and imagination as it follows Rose, a young girl who invents detailed maps to explore fantastical worlds. Suitable for children ages 5-8, the story gently inspires curiosity and self-expression without any challenging content. It offers a warm, imaginative journey perfect for young readers beginning to explore fiction.

Why we rated My heart is a compass 6C

My heart is a compass is written at a Level 1-2 reading level across 40 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 2.5 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, My heart is a compass works for readers up to grade 3.5.

We rate My heart is a compass as 6C ("Clear")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.

No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.

Thematically, My heart is a compass explores imagination, adventure, creativity, voyages and travels, and cartography —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
